Comments:
An unannounced monitoring inspection was conducted today from 11:20am until 1:00pm in conjunction with a complaint investigation.
Classrooms were observed, and a review of 8 staff records, 4 children's medications, 7 children?s records, emergency drills, and supplies was completed. During the inspection there were 99 children under the supervision on 21 staff members. Children were observed eating lunch consisting of tortilla, beans corn, oranges and milk. Diaper changing procedures were also observed.

Areas of non compliance can be found on the violation notice.

Violations:
Standard #: 22.1-289.035-B-4
Description: Based on record review, the center failed to obtain an out-of-state criminal record check and out-of-state central registry check for states listed as a state of residence of staff members in the preceding five years.
Evidence:
Staff 2? s record lists residing in Washington, California, and North Carolina within the preceding five years. There was no documentation of a request or results of a central registry check for each state, or a criminal record check or results from Washington and California.

Standard #: 8VAC20-780-500-A
Description: Based on observation, staff failed to wash hands with soap and running water after diaper changing.
Evidence:
A staff member in the infant room was observed to change a child?s diaper, then remove soiled gloves to open a cabinet, spray the diapering surface and record information on the classroom tablet. The staff washed their hands after these tasks were complete.
